Michael Dale Mills
Aug.  8, 1949-Dec. 31, 1950

Niles Daily Star, Tuesday, January 2, 1951; page 2, col. 5, microfilm, Niles District Library

Michael Dale Mills, 1, son of Mr. and Mrs. Dale Mills, of rural route five, died at 1 p.m. Sunday at Pawating hospital after being ill for two days.

Also surviving are two great-grandparents, William Wedel, of Eau Claire, and Ernest Trusner, of Anderson, Ind.,  and four grandparents, Mr. and Mrs. Elbert Mills, of Niles, and Mr. and Mrs. Gerold Wedel, of Eau Claire.

He was born Aug. 8, 1949, in Pawating hospital.

Services were conducted by the Rev. T. M. Greenhoe at 3 p.m. today at the Kiger funeral home.  Burial was in Silverbrook cemetery.

Alfred Millspaugh
May 24, 1876-Nov. 6, 1954

Niles Daily Star, Monday, November 8, 1954, page 2, col. 4-5, microfilm Niles District Library 

Alfred Millspaugh, 78, a retired attorney who came to Niles in 1953, died at 1:15 p.m. , Saturday in Pawating Hospital. He had been ill for some time.

Mr. Millspaugh lived at 3148 South Third street road. He was born May 24, 1876 in New Haven, Mich., and came to Niles from Detroit on Dec. 4, 1953.

Surviving is the widow, Ethel.

Friends may call at the Pifer Funeral Home where funeral services will be held at 2 p.m Tuesday.  Masonic rites will be conducted at the funeral home and at Silverbrook cemetery, where burial will be made.

Grace B. Robinson
Oct. 1, 1878-Jan. 13, 1955

Niles Daily Star, Friday, January 14, 1955, page 2, col. 5, microfilm Niles District Library 

Mrs. Grace B. Robinson, 76, of 15 North Seventh, died at 8 p.m. Thursday in the Berrien County Hospital followingan illness of one month. She had been in the hospital for the past two weeks.

Mrs. Robinson was born Oct. 1, 1878, in Dayton, Mich., and had lived most of her life in Mishawaka, Ind., and Niles.  Her husband, George, died in 1947.

Surviving are: a daughter, Mrs. Mabelle Beall, of Niles; a son, Clifford H. Perry, of Ishpeming; two grandchildren, and two great-grandchildren.

Funeral services will be held at 2 p.m. Monday in the Kiger Funeral Home here. Burial will be in Silverbrook Cemetery.  Friends may call at the funeral home beginning Saturday evening.

Benjamin H. Smith
Feb. 7, 1878-Oct. 17, 1954

Niles Daily Star, Monday, October 18, 1954, page 2, col. 5, microfilm Niles District Library

Benjamin H. Smith, 731 Hickory street, vice president of the Michigan Wire Goods Company and active . . .[illegible] . . last Monday.

His wife, Grace, died on March 8, 1953. Surviving are two sons, Mahlon, of Niles, and Rolland, of New Orleans, La.; one daughter, Mrs. Dale Apt, of South Bend, and two grandchildren.

Smith was born Feb. 7, 1878, in Coldwater Township, Branch County, and came here from Coldwater in 1902.  He was a graduate of Cleary Business College, at Ypsilanti, and was a member of the Rotary Club, the Knights of Pythias, was a director of the Niles Federal Savings and Loan Association, chairman of the local Cemetery Board, trustee of the First Methodist Church, member of the South Bend Knife and Fork Club, and president of the Buff Wyandotte Club.

Friends may call at the Pifer Funeral Home. Services will be held at 2 p.m. Tuesday at the First Methodist Church, with the Rev. L. George Beacock, Methodist pastor, presiding.  Burial was in Silverbrook Cemetery.

William H. Wharton
July 26, 1878-July 13, 1954

Niles Daily Star, Thursday, July 15, 1954, page 2 col. 5, microfilm Niles District Library

William H. Wharton, 2114 Portland avenue, Nashville, Tenn., who moved from Niles several years ago, died Tuesday at Chattanooga, Tenn. He had been ill 10 months.

Surviving are his wife, Sue; one daughter, Mrs. J.F. Conover, Nashville, Tenn.; two sisters, Mrs. T.P. Yeatman, Columbia, Tenn., and Miss Anne L. Wharton, Chattanooga, Tenn., and one brother, Richard C. Wharton, Nashville, Tenn.

He was born on July 26, 1878, and moved from Niles several years ago. He was retired general agent of the N.C. & St. L. Railroad of Nashville, Tenn., and married the former Sue Landon of Niles.

He was a member of Trinity Episcopal Church, Nashville.  Arrangements are being made by the Kiger Funeral Home for graveside services at 1 p.m. Friday at Silverbrook Cemetery. The body will be taken directly from the train to the cemetery.
